    Watch: The implications of the Gates' divorce on philanthropy

    Devex Editor-in-Chief Raj Kumar and Senior Reporter Catherine Cheney discuss how Bill and Melinda Gates' divorce might impact their philanthropy and global development more broadly.

    By Raj Kumar // 05 May 2021
    The divorce of Bill and Melinda Gates is a private matter with public implications, especially for the global development community. Devex's President and Editor-in-Chief Raj Kumar and Senior Reporter Catherine Cheney discuss these implications and what the future may hold for the world's largest philanthropy.       Raj Kumar is the President and Editor-in-Chief at Devex, the media platform for the global development community. He is a media leader and former humanitarian council chair for the World Economic Forum and a member of the Council on Foreign Relations. His work has led him to more than 50 countries, where he has had the honor to meet many of the aid workers and development professionals who make up the Devex community. He is the author of the book "The Business of Changing the World," a go-to primer on the ideas, people, and technology disrupting the aid industry.
